Chemical exposure cases in Murray often come down to workplace activity and surrounding site conditions. Common local scenarios include:
- Maintenance and cleaning in industrial/commercial settings (fumes from solvents, degreasers, or caustic cleaners)
- Transportation-related incidents (truck loading/unloading, tanker leaks, chemical odors after roadway or facility events)
- Construction and contracting work (dust plus chemical treatments, adhesives, sealants, or protective coatings)
- Seasonal weather effects that concentrate odors or irritants outdoors—leading to repeated exposure complaints
If symptoms started after a specific incident—or worsened after returning to the same environment—those details can be crucial for building a strong Kentucky case.
